• 如何将list集合转成String对象


    使用Stringutils中的join方法:

    方法一:

    public String listToString(List list, char separator) {    
      return org.apache.commons.lang.StringUtils.join(list.toArray(),separator);   
    }

    方法二:

    public String listToString(List list, char separator) {    
        StringBuilder sb = new StringBuilder();    
        for (int i = 0; i < list.size(); i++) {        
            if (i == list.size() - 1) {            
               sb.append(list.get(i));        
            } else {            
              sb.append(list.get(i));            
              sb.append(separator);        
            }   
         }    
      return sb.toString();}

    方法三:

    public String listToString(List list, char separator) {    
        StringBuilder sb = new StringBuilder();    
        for (int i = 0; i < list.size(); i++) {                
                     sb.append(list.get(i)).append(separator);    
               }    
                return sb.toString().substring(0,sb.toString().length()-1);
         }
  • 相关阅读:
    复数加法
    通过函数来实现复数相加
    声明一个类模板
    友元成员函数的简单应用
    将普通函数声明为友元函数
    引用静态数据成员
    对象的赋值
    对象的常引用
    有关对象指针的使用方法
    对象数组的使用方法
  • 原文地址:https://www.cnblogs.com/qingmuchuanqi48/p/12013880.html
Copyright © 2020-2023  润新知